Toddlers are famously selective eaters. Their taste buds are still developing, their appetites vary daily, and their short attention spans make mealtime a stress zone. Instead of fighting over what’s on the plate, create meals that invite exploration—simple, colorful, and perfectly portioned. When kids feel in control, they’re far more likely to dig in and enjoy every bite.
5 Toddler-Friendly Lunch Ideas That Succeed Instantly
1. Rainbow Veggie & Dip Combo
Fresh, colorful veggies like age-appropriate carrot sticks, cucumber rounds, and cherry tomatoes invite little hands to pick and explore. Serve with a side of hummus, avocado puree, or yogurt dip in a fun silicone mold. The bright hues spark curiosity—just ask your toddler to “make their rainbow plate!” Kids eat what they’ve touching, and taste testing becomes a game.

Tip: Let your toddler arrange their own “veggie towers” on a plate—visual appeal encourages participation without pressure.
2. Mini Moon Sandwiches with Hidden Sweetness
Use whole-grain mini wraps or weltpar biscuits cut into fun shapes (circles, stars, hearts). Fill with soft mashed avocado, scrambled eggs, or sweet compostable bean dip. The familiar sandwich format meets unexpected taste—your toddler might never notice the healthy twist until they taste it!
3. Fun-Filled Fruit Popsicle Cups
Blend fruit puree with a splash of 100% juice, pour into popsicle molds, and freeze. Use cookie cutters shaped like animals or their favorite characters. These pops aren’t just snacks—they’re an edible canvas that lights up mealtime and keeps them satisfied longer. Bonus: no messy sticky hands!
4. Cheesy Rainbow Cups with Soft Bites
Layer shredded cheese (like mozzarella or cheddar) with roasted veggies, steamed peas, and a dollop of mild pesto or stir-fry sauce. Use small cups or divet plates to showcase colorful layers. Toddlers love food that looks like a storybook—each spoonful reveals a new color and flavor.
5. Build-Your-Own Mini Tacos
Offer soft tortillas filled with shredded chicken, black beans, shredded cheese, and sweet bell peppers—let your toddler assemble their own. No pressure—just fun participation. The interactive format builds autonomy and makes snack time feel like a child-led project.

Why These Ideas Work: The Psychology Behind Self-Serve Eating
Toddlers thrive when given choices and small responsibilities. These meals are designed not only to be nutritious but also to turn eating into play—a proven way to boost interest and reduce resistance. Simple shapes, vibrant colors, and familiar foods paired in playful presentations help kids feel confident and curious, not overwhelmed.
